SOVIET CLAIMS THAT RUSSIAN WAS FIRST TO LOOP THE LOOP
NZPA—Copyright Rec. 9.26 p.m. WASHINGTON, May 16. The Soviet’s recent claim that a Russian was the first to loop the loop in an aeroplane indicates that Russian propagandists have exhausted the list of really worthwhile claims, and are now in the embarrassing position of having to boast of trivial discoveries or second-rate inventions in order to keep up the campaign of national selfglorification. *
